Aceh, an Indonesian province on Sumatra’s northern tip, offers a variety of experiences. Here you can visit the Blang Kolam waterfalls, surrounded by lush rainforest, or explore the PLTD Apung, a ship that was carried inland by the tsunami. Gunung Leuser National Park offers secluded jungle adventures, while the Negeri Banda Aceh Museum provides cultural insights. Relax on Lampuuk beach or immerse yourself in history with a visit to Kherkhof or Mesjid Raya Baiturrahman. For active vacationers, Lhok Nga offers ideal conditions for surfing.

Travel guide: Aceh: A hidden paradise in Indonesia
Indonesia’s northernmost province of Aceh enchants with its fascinating mix of pristine beaches, rich history and cultural diversity. This region, which stretches from the green hills to the azure waters, offers unique experiences for every visitor.
Sights and excursion destinations
Aceh is full of historical and natural treasures to explore:
- Baiturrahman Grand Mosque: A magnificent mosque that stands as a symbol of hope and reconstruction after the 2004 tsunami.
- Tsunami Museum: A poignant museum dedicated to the victims of the tsunami and thought-provoking.
- Pulau Weh: A breathtaking island at the northernmost point of Sumatra, known for its excellent diving spots.
- Lhoknga Beach: A popular beach for surfers with impressive waves and picturesque sunsets.
- Gunongan Historical Park: A historical monument built by a sultan for his beloved wife.

History of the place
Aceh has a long and eventful history, characterized by trade, Islamic culture and the struggle for independence. The region became particularly well known after the tragic events of the tsunami in 2004, which also led to a new sense of cohesion and reconstruction.
Eating, drinking and shopping
Aceh’s cuisine is known for its spicy and aromatic dishes. Be sure to try the traditional Nasi Goreng Aceh. You can find a variety of handicrafts and souvenirs at local markets.
